Back in February my then property manager had my rental property fumigated, without my authority or knowledge, when the tenant complained about some spiders. They deducted the cost of it from the rent along with their management fees, which is the first I knew of it.
When I changed property managers in June, the tenant complained that the fumigator had damaged an item of her furniture - the property manager had arranged a repair at the time, and charged the fumigator, but the tenant was not happy with it. I told her to get in contact with the old property manager, as I knew nothing about it. She never did.
Now that the tenant has moved out, she has taken the issue to the tenancy tribunal, who have told her to get quotes for repairs - I am going to have to pay for it! I am stunned that I am responsible when I didn't authorise the fumigation, or even know about it at the time - and I never would have agreed to it if they had asked in advance.
Has anyone been in a similar situation, or can give advice on what I should do? What would be my chances of getting the old property manages to compensate me for the repairs I now have to pay for?
